Duties:

  • Greets and rooms patients in room; measures and obtains patient vital signs including height and weight, and records information on patient's chart.
  • Collects and documents patient data to support the clinical visit.
  • Enter labs, x-rays, and other diagnostics per protocol or as directed by provider.
  • Prepares, cleans, and disinfects exam and treatment rooms, necessary equipment and instruments, and ensures rooms are free from clutter and hazardous materials.
  • Reprocesses reusable instruments within the practice.
  • Orders, stocks, and maintains exam rooms, special order items, supply storage areas, medications, forms, and equipment.
  • Schedules, sends reminders, and cancels patient appointments as requested.
  • Enters incoming referrals, obtains insurance authorizations, and coordinates outgoing referrals.
  • Processes routine patient calls, per established protocols, and answers patient questions.
  • Assists patients and families with identifying community resources to ensure healthcare needs are met.
  • May handle biomedical, pharmaceutical, hazardous and universal wastes per regulatory and accreditation requirements and standards.
  • Understands and if assigned, demonstrates the ability to safety handle hazardous drugs which may include receipt, storage, compound, repackaging, dispensing, transporting and/or disposing of hazardous drugs.
